Chestnut and ginkgo rice cooked

Ginkgo trees will discolor when cooked with rice and will look unapproachable. It is best to fried it and mix it with cooked rice.

How to make it
1

The ginkgo trees are peeled and then deep-fried, peeled thin skin and used.

2

Add the rice that has been soaked in the rice cooker, the chestnuts that have been peeled and halved with the shell, and [A] to cook rice.

3

Once cooked, add the ginkgo noodles and mix quickly.

4

Serve in a bowl and it's finished.

Materials for 6 people
  • Rice
    2 go
  • With the chestnut shell
    150g
  • ginkgo
    50g
  • [A]
    kelp
    5g
  • water
    2 cups
  • Alcohol
    1 tablespoon
  • salt
    1 tsp
